Exactly what is soda water?

It is carbonate drinking water, at times referred to as “sparkling water”, and it is ordinary ole water which carbon dioxide gas has been added. It’s the primary component of most “soft drinks”. This technique of carbonation forms carbonic acid which is soda pop.

Soda water, occasionally called club soda, had been produced during the past at home by using a seltzer bottle filled with drinking water and after that “charged” with carbon dioxide. Sparkling mineral water sometimes causes a little tooth decay. While the potential issue associated with sparkling water is more than still water the problem remains low. Regular soft drinks cause tooth decay at a rate much higher than sparkling water. The actual pace can be so low this suggests that carbonation of beverages may not be an aspect in causing dental decay.

Water which comes from the ground – generally from artesian wells – and filtered among layers of mineral deposits that contains some type of carbonates might absorb the carbon dioxide gas released because of the carbonates. This water is called natural sparkling water. In the event the water also accumulates enough various minerals to add a flavor to the water this will become sparkling mineral water.

Basically, soda water is simply drinking water and also carbon dioxide. Sparkling mineral water is a carbonation which is naturally-occurring. In 1794, a jeweler created a device to make a carbonate man-made mineral water.

In a taste test involving several carbonate beverages, it had been discovered that Perrier, a sparkling natural mineral water, kept its fizz the longest.

For consumers who think seltzer as being a bit harsh, club soda features a gentle fizz. As part of the tasting test, it was observed that club soda seemed to be milder plus a bit sweeter tasting than regular carbonate water.

Club soda, sparkling mineral water, seltzer as well as carbonate water have zero calories, that make these any dieters preference over soda pop and tonic drinking water.

Tonic water is really a carbonate beverage that contains drinking water, sugar, carbon dioxide as well as quinine. Quinine was originately put into tonic water to help treat or avoid malaria. Nowadays it is actually commonly combined with gin as well as lime or lemon for an alcoholic beverage.
